The Crystal Coast Wedding Salon is a destination wedding showcase tailored to meet the needs of the sophisticated Crystal Coast destination bride. The Wedding Salon isn't your average bridal show. It is a weekend-long event offering area wedding companies a unique showcase with the opportunity to build lasting relationships with Crystal Coast destination brides.
The Coral Bay Club will house our Saturday Showcase. Designed in true reception style, the Showcase is an intimate, free-flowing event with no pipe and drape or endless rows of vendors. The relaxed environment gives vendors room to design and showcase products and services creatively, with flair.
Our event venue tours are perhaps the most unique element of the Salon. We bring couples to your facility, giving you the opportunity to showcase your venue’s uniqueness. You will have 30-45 minutes to tour your facility and create an ambiance that’s reflective of your space.
And at our Saturday Night After Party, hosted by the North Carolina Aquarium and Floyds 1921 Catering, everyone is invited to let down their hair, relax, and socialize with our attending couples and other vendors.
